JERK is a method of curing or preserving meat by slicing it into strips and
drying these in the sun or over a fire. Jerked meat is common to different
cultures, but Jamaican jerk is unique. The meat is highly seasoned before
being smoked on a grill.
Jamaican jerk was developed over 300 years ago by the Maroons. When the
British invaded Jamaica in 1655 the Spaniards fled to Cuba leaving behind their
slaves, who ran away and hid in the mountains. Known as Maroons, the runaway
slaves avoided capture by moving about from place to place. While on the
move, the Maroons lived on wild boar which they captured. They developed a
method of seasoning the meat and then smoking it over a fire on branches of the
pimento (allspice) tree. In 1739 the British signed a treaty with the Maroons
granting them lands and virtual independence. Jamaican jerk was the Maroons'
gift to us.
Busha Browne's Authentic Jerk Seasoning is a blend of herbs and spices
including Jamaican pimento (allspice) to create a 'hot' rub. The aroma is
irresistible and the taste delicious.
